1/16/2018. In the iNEST maker club this week, students continued working with our Scratch coding cards to learn basic programming behind their forthcoming Hummingbird robotics projects. Deborah began today's meeting by showing several sample videos of what students can build with Hummingbird. Kevin and Jennifer sorted the Hummingbird materials into bags (one part per bag) that will be doled out next week when students start working with the equipment. Club mentors also finished loading the Bird Brain Robot Server and Scratch 2.0 programs on selected laptops that students will need next week when working with the Hummingbird kits. Next week, students will receive a template asking them to design and sketch their robot, selecting at least one sensor and one effector for the robot, and indicating the Scratch code blocks that will be needed to program the robot.
